Description
This Strawberry Banana Smoothie Bowl is a refreshing, nutrient-packed breakfast or snack option that combines creamy frozen fruits with a variety of crunchy, flavorful toppings. It’s quick to prepare, naturally sweetened, and customizable to suit your taste.
Ingredients
Scale
Base Smoothie
- 2 frozen bananas
- 1 1/2 cups frozen strawberries
- 1/2 cup almond milk (or any milk of choice)
- 1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up (optional)
Toppings
- Fresh strawberries, sliced
- Sliced bananas
- Granola
- Chia seeds
- Coconut flakes
- Sliced almonds
Instructions
- Combine Ingredients: In a blender, add the frozen bananas, frozen strawberries, almond milk, and honey or maple syrup if using. This mixture will form the creamy base of your smoothie bowl.
- Blend Smoothly: Blend on high speed until the mixture is smooth and creamy, scraping down the sides of the blender as needed to get an even texture without chunks.
- Pour into Bowl: Pour the blended smoothie into a bowl and use a spoon to smooth the surface for a nice presentation.
- Add Toppings: Decorate the top of your smoothie bowl with fresh strawberry slices, banana slices, granola, chia seeds, coconut flakes, and sliced almonds for added texture and flavor.
- Serve Immediately: Enjoy your smoothie bowl right away for the best fresh and cool taste experience.
Notes
- You can substitute almond milk with any milk of choice such as oat, soy, or dairy milk.
- Adjust the sweetness by omitting or adding more honey or maple syrup according to your preference.
- Feel free to customize toppings with your favorite nuts, seeds, or fresh fruits.
- For a thicker consistency, use less milk; for a thinner one, add a bit more.
- To prep ahead, freeze fresh bananas and strawberries in advance for convenience.
